Transaction 7e6c61d7f166a4f33c2d2b81fc920fa6a0cdd6c90914007a44f598ffab4e2339
1 Input
1 Output
-
7e6c61d7f166a4f33c2d2b81fc920fa6a0cdd6c90914007a44f598ffab4e2339:0
- value
- 6379156
- script pubkey
- OP_0 OP_PUSHBYTES_20 f38ae26eafeec73c5dfe2e889c41bc7668792d3b
- address
- bc1q7w9wym40amrnch0796yfcsduwe58jtfm5kesfq